[quote name='Traitorious']Eh, I think it depends on the item and location.[/quote]

I really don't think it does (at least within the U.S., I don't know about other countries).

The only scalping laws deal with being within a certain distance of a sporting event, usually within a mile. Most people incorrectly think that it's illegal to sell sporting tickets for more than face value. It isn't, it's just illegal to do it right outside the stadium at some events.

[quote name='MarkMan']Yes, that's one very big benefit to using a stick that clicks. You KNOW it's working.


Also! Anyone have any comments on the product after they tried them out? Gimme some background info... I like to hear about things so I can hope to further improve the design of future sticks.[/QUOTE]

You guys did a great job on the design and it being noob friendly to mod.

I find the slant on the SE stick very comfortable on my palms. The Madcatz Sanwa knockoff parts are very disappointing once you feel the real deal. But to a new stick owner they wouldn't know the difference. I thought the buttons were great until I got my TE in, then I realized that I couldn't enjoy the buttons on the SE anymore.

The TE stick is amazing, not as comfortable but I'm guessing it's not meant to be played in your lap. My arm is constantly rubbing on the left corner of the casing. Very irritating. But other than that the only thing I can complain about is that the buttons are a little too close to the stick, but it's worth it for the nice 8-button layout.
Not sure what Sanwa stick is in the TE's but the JLF I ordered seemed to be not as tight as the TE one.
Also both sticks are incredibly noob friendly to mod. I switch the buttons on both sticks my first time in less than 1/2 hour.

[quote name='greyzieoriental']The TE stick is amazing, not as comfortable but I'm guessing it's not meant to be played in your lap. My arm is constantly rubbing on the left corner of the casing. Very irritating. But other than that the only thing I can complain about is that the buttons are a little too close to the stick, but it's worth it for the nice 8-button layout.[/QUOTE]

I agree with greyz on the topic of it not being as comfortable. I'll want to clock in more time, but a couple things I noticed was that I *DO* rest the joystick in my lap. I was thankful that the rubber feet on the bottom did not dig into my legs. I like the angle of the stick, but my right wrist keeps finding that little screw on the bottom right of the faceplate. That is a little annoying, but if i'm careful about where I lay my right hand/wrist then its not too much of an issue.

I also prefer the ball type control stick as it feels i'm making less movement vs. using a bat top based stick. I would agree that the 8 buttons on the face are perhaps a *bit* too close to the stick. For the most part, it is a non-issue and i'm being nit-picky here. If I could move all the buttons 1" over to the right, that would be fantastic. Definitely the low-profile, non-tactile buttons are a winner for this stick.

As far as background history goes. I currently own the Nubytech Street Fighter Anniversary joystick. I also own the Hori Tekken 5 Anniversary Stick. I enjoy both of those sticks greatly, however the Tekken 5 stick is the better of the two. Without any shadow of doubt, the SFIV:TE stick puts it to rest. Both in terms of construction and in quality of components used.
